Vladimir Ozerov updated IGNITE-3195: ------------------------------------ Fix Version/s: (was: 2.7) > Rebalancing: IgniteConfiguration.rebalanceThreadPoolSize is wrongly treated > --------------------------------------------------------------------------- > > Key: IGNITE-3195 > UR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/IGNITE-3195 > Project: Ignite > Issue Type: Bug > Components: cache > Reporter: Denis Magda > Priority: Major > > Presently it's considered that the maximum number of threads that has to > process all demand and supply messages coming from all the nodes must not be > bigger than {{IgniteConfiguration.rebalanceThreadPoolSize}}. > Current implementation relies on ordered messages functionality creating a > number of topics equal to {{IgniteConfiguration.rebalanceThreadPoolSize}}. > However, the implementation doesn't take into account that ordered messages, > that correspond to a particular topic, are processed in parallel for > different nodes. Refer to the implementation of > {{GridIoManager.processOrderedMessage}} to see that for every topic there > will be a unique {{GridCommunicationMessageSet}} for every node. > Also to prove that this is true you can refer to this execution stack > {noformat} > java.lang.RuntimeException: HAPPENED DEMAND >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.processors.cache.GridCachePartitionExchangeManager$5.apply(GridCachePartitionExchangeManager.java:378) >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.processors.cache.GridCachePartitionExchangeManager$5.apply(GridCachePartitionExchangeManager.java:364) >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.processors.cache.GridCacheIoManager.processMessage(GridCacheIoManager.java:622) >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.processors.cache.GridCacheIoManager.onMessage0(GridCacheIoManager.java:320) >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.processors.cache.GridCacheIoManager.access$300(GridCacheIoManager.java:81) >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.processors.cache.GridCacheIoManager$OrderedMessageListener.onMessage(GridCacheIoManager.java:1125) >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.managers.communication.GridIoManager.invokeListener(GridIoManager.java:1219) >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.managers.communication.GridIoManager.access$1600(GridIoManager.java:105) >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.managers.communication.GridIoManager$GridCommunicationMessageSet.unwind(GridIoManager.java:2456) >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.managers.communication.GridIoManager.unwindMessageSet(GridIoManager.java:1179) >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.managers.communication.GridIoManager.access$1900(GridIoManager.java:105) > at > org.apache.ignite.internal.managers.communication.GridIoManager$6.run(GridIoManager.java:1148) > at > java.util.concurrent.ThreadPoolExecutor.runWorker(ThreadPoolExecutor.java:1142) > at > java.util.concurrent.ThreadPoolExecutor$Worker.run(ThreadPoolExecutor.java:617) > at java.lang.Thread.run(Thread.java:745) > {noformat} > All this means that in fact the number of threads that will be busy with > replication activity will be equal to > {{IgniteConfiguration.rebalanceThreadPoolSize}} x > number_of_nodes_participated_in_rebalancing -- This message was sent by Atlassian JIRA (v7.6.3#76005)
